7. Set Your Terms In Writing
If you have covered everything that you need for your move and if you have already made up your mind about the moving company you want to hire, remember to make your sample agreement official by putting it in writing. Ask for a contract and it would also help if you make a draft of your own terms, so that you and the other party can meet halfway and make adjustments to what you want accomplished, as necessary. 8. Charges and Additional Costs
The sample contract should have the type of services provided, described in detail including added services you may require. It should also include the charges for each service and it’s really important that you know what you’re being charged with. There should be no surprise charges and this is exactly why you need to have a written simple agreement. Anything that isn’t there cannot be held against you. Any additional expenses should still be included in the simple contract. It is important to have everything spelled out clearly in case of disputes.
9. Payment
Write down how the contractor would be paid, and include the date and time, as well as the mode of payment for each payment you would be doing, except for cases where you have agreed to pay in full, one-time. Make sure you know what the estimated figures amount to and make necessary adjustments as early as when you have read the terms and conditions so that it can still be amended before you sign it. Review your part of the deal and make sure you understand what you’re agreeing to. Should you have any doubts with what you’re reading, ask for legal advice or review the contract with a legal expert.
